Add Symptoms Adults

human-givens-institute-logo.pngPeople with ADD might lose their keys or appointments, and find it difficult to keep the track of their activities. They may be restless and easily distracted, or even susceptible to daydreaming.

These behaviors can cause issues in work and life particularly if they go undiagnosed or are not understood. ADD is an old term, but it's still used by a variety of medical professionals to describe Predominantly inattentive Type ADHD.

1. Disorganization

Disorganization is among the first signs adults with ADD observe. They're messy, fail to finish tasks on time or forget to complete daily duties (such as chores and run-of-the-mills). They may also lose things needed for work or daily life, like glasses, wallets, keys and cell phone. They are unable to maintain tidy and organized desks or work spaces and frequently lose assignments from school or homework. These signs can be difficult for friends and family however, they are often overlooked because they are mistaken for normal behavior.

Researchers have discovered that inattention ADHD symptoms are associated with impairments in working memory (WM). Working memory (WM) is an essential cognitive function that involves the storage of information and manipulation during the course of completing tasks. It's a crucial element of daily life, and it can impact every area of your life, from your career to your personal relationships.

Inattention is thought to be a factor in poor WM, as it affects the quality and amount of information that is available to the WM. However, research has revealed, that inattention is only one of many impairments affecting WM. It is possible that other factors contribute to the poor performance of WM in ADHD. This could include executive function deficits as well as depression and anxiety.

People ages 17 and older can be diagnosed with adhd Symptoms in adults males - botdb.win, if they've experienced ADHD symptoms since before age 12 and have at least six daily symptoms of inattention and/or five symptoms of hyperactivity-impulsivity that interfere with their social, family, and work functioning. Anxiety, depression and sleep disorders may cause similar symptoms, and healthcare professionals will perform evaluations to rule out other causes.
